Charity overview

Activities - how the charity spends its money

The promotion of physical and mental well being of children and young people who are patients in hospital, hospice or receiving medical care at home by the promotion of high professional standards of play staff; to ensure the provision of appropriate theraputic and stimulating play facilities and support to those who carry out this work.
